JBS in Marshalltown is a pork processing facility owned by JBS USA, a global food company. JBS USA Pork is the 2nd largest fresh pork producer in the U.S. Currently, the Marshalltown plant has 2,400 total employees. JBS has been an ongoing recipient of 260E and 260F funding for their workforce. Iowa Valley Community College District has been providing industrial maintenance training to JBS for over 20 years.
As JBS hires new mechanics or promotes from within the company, they send these employees to the Marshalltown campus for Industrial Maintenance Training, specifically utilizing the Amatrol lab. The training is a hybrid approach where the employee can do online learning using the college’s laptops on the Marshalltown campus and have the instructor nearby if they have questions as they go through each module. To complete the course, they must pass a hands-on assessment using the Amatrol equipment, which is conducted with the instructor onsite.
This is ongoing training and is self-paced. Some students are done with this training in 6 months, but most take 9 months or even up to a year. Once they complete the course, JBS increases their wages.
